Output 90e8a16af284ce0c93c1d7821599e139e82594c00c479fcb862583e5c6b7871d:0

value
20597386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dee279428c1e78ada1de6069a247639da8aa8b7 OP_EQUAL
address
MC61wLMk9gyyumS5ixxHj6MM5n53dBeZoE
transaction
90e8a16af284ce0c93c1d7821599e139e82594c00c479fcb862583e5c6b7871d
spent
true